Federal Capital Territory (FCT) Ministe, Nyesom Wike has strongly criticized Senator Ireti Kinigbe, predicting that she will lose the support of the people in the next election.
Senator Kingibe had publicly criticized the Wike-led administration during a television appearance, declaring that she is not an ally of the minister.
In response, during the flag-off ceremony of the Mabushi Bus Terminal in Abuja on Monday, July 1, Minister Wike expressed disappointment over Kingibe’s stance.
He noted that instead of fostering collaboration with the FCT Administration, Kingibe appeared more concerned about residents praising President Bola Tinubu’s administration.
He said “I overheard somebody on Arise TV this morning. Unfortunately, I hear the person is a member of the National Assembly and it is unfortunate I say so. With all due respect, what you don’t know, you don’t know, what you know you know, and the good thing for you is to tell people you don’t when you don’t know, then people will educate you.
“The Honourable Minister of state and my humble self-have not been in office for more than 11 months and the person is angry that they are praising us. If you don’t want or you are angry about that, go and hang yourself on a transformer. If we have done well, we have done well. If we haven’t done well, we haven’t done well. I am proud to say that in the short time that Mr. President has appointed us, we have done well.
“You said there are no hospital and there are no hospitals. You, as a legislator, what have you done? How many bills have you sponsored for us to improve our education and health sector?
“I challenge that legislator. If you are very popular, 2027 come and run under Abuja, we will fail you. Do you think that what happened last time, will happen again? It will not happen again. Luckily for me, I am the FCT Minister now. So that is my territory and I’m not afraid.”
